ROBERT BIALE Zinfandel 'Founding Farmers' 2014

The 'Founding Farmers' Zinfandel weighs in at 15.2% alcohol but comes across very structured. This balanced Zinfandel opens with aromas of prune, spicecake and blackberry jam. There are flavors of black cherry, coffee grounds, black plum and prune. This is impossible to resist right now and is exceedingly balanced considering the heat of the vintage. The structure of the wine borders Bordelaise, as this wine represents an exceedingly good value in California Zinfandel. (Best 2016-2023) - July, 2016 (OB)
